Two-step authentication using SMS text messages

You can set up your mobile device to receive a one-time six-digit code that is sent in an SMS text message to your mobile device when you log in to your account. You'll need to manually enter this code in addition to your other credentials.

Steps:

  1. From your Shopify admin, click your username and account picture.
  2. Click Manage account > Security.

  3. In the Two-step authentication section, click Turn on two-step.

  4. Enter your password, and then click Next.

  5. From the Authentication method list, select SMS delivery.

  6. Select a country code, and then enter your phone number.

  7. Click Send authentication code.

  8. Check your mobile phone for an SMS text message.

  9. Retrieve the six-digit code from the text message, and then enter it under CHECK YOUR PHONE.

  10. Click Turn on.

  11. Save your recovery codes in case you lose access to your mobile device. Make sure that you store them in a safe location offline that you can access in multiple ways, such as from your mobile device, your desktop computer, and from a printed document.

Now when you try to log in, you require your mobile phone for two-step authentication.

You can add one or more different phone numbers as a backup authentication method.
